它将为 Kubernetes 组件如何与集群中涉及的关键配置进行交互打下坚实的基础。 4.Kubernetes Minikube 教程 5.使用 Kubeadm 设置 Kubernetes 集群 6.Kubeconfig 文件解释 7.kubernetes集群配置文件 8.如何在 Vagrant VM 上启动 Kubernetes 集群 Kubectl 教程 使用Kube
cat > /k8s/kubernetes/cfg/kube-controller-manager.conf <<'EOF' KUBE_CONTROLLER_MANAGER_OPTS="--leader-elect=true \ --master=127.0.0.1:8080 \ --address=127.0.0.1 \ --allocate-node-cidrs=true \ --cluster-cidr=10.244.0.0/16 \ --service-cluster-ip-range=10.0.0.0/24 \ --cluster-signin...
我们开始部署一个应用即deployments,kubernetes中包含各种workload如无状态话的Deployments,有状态化的StatefulSets,守护进程的DaemonSets,每种workload对应不同的应用场景,我们先以Deployments为例入门,其他workload均以此类似,一般而言,在kubernetes中部署应用均以yaml文件方式部署,对于初学者而言,编写yaml文件太冗长,不适合初...
1、获取metric-server安装文件,当前具有两个版本:1.7和1.8+,kubernetes1.7版本安装1.7的metric-server版本,kubernetes 1.8后版本安装metric server 1.8+版本 代码语言:txt AI代码解释 [root@node-1 ~]# git clone https://github.com/kubernetes-sigs/metrics-server.git 2、部署metric-server,部署1.8+版本 代码语言...
八、*安装Kubernetes (一)、安装kubectl (二)、安装kubeadm 九、*搭建Kubernetes集群 (一)、环境准备 (二)、* 初始化控制平面节点/Master (三)、Node节点加入Master 十、有代理的情况下如何搭建Kubernetes集群 kubernetes(k8s)自2014年9月推出以来已经经历了快8年,特别是近几年在国内一片大热,在所有容器编排工具中...
8.1 卸载Kubernetes 8.2 calico.yaml 8.3 dashboard.yaml 1. 概念 k8s是什么? 从logo来看,是Docker的掌舵者 2. 历史和特征 Google编写并开源的,10年容器化基础架构的经验 特点: 1、轻量级,采用Go语言编写,消耗资源小; 2、弹性伸缩,云原生提到的可持续性交付; 3、负载均衡; 详细特征: 服务发现和负载均衡 Kubern...
架构和组件Kubernetes 集群,具有两种类型的资源:控制平面和节点。每个集群都有一组工作节点,它们在 Pod 上运行容器化应用程序,Pod 代表一个或多个共置容器。这些节点由控制平面管理,如下图所示。在生产环境中,集群将包含多个工作节点,控制平面将跨多台机器运行,以确保高可用性和容错能力。控制平面组件下面讨论...
1.1 Kubernetes介绍 1.2 基本架构与常用术语 2.Kubernetes集群 2.1 环境准备与规划 2.2 Master安装 2.3 Node1安装 2.4 Node2安装 2.5 健康检查与示例测试 1.Kubernetes概述 1.1 Kubernetes介绍 1.1.1 Kubernetes是什么及作用 Kubernetes(K8S)是Google在2014年发布的一个开源项目,用于自动化容器化应用程序的部署、扩展和...
Node(节点)是 kubernetes 集群中的计算机,可以是虚拟机或物理机。每个 Node(节点)都由 master 管理。一个 Node(节点)可以有多个Pod(容器组),kubernetes master 会根据每个 Node(节点)上可用资源的情况,自动调度 Pod(容器组)到最佳的 Node(节点)上。 每个Kubernetes Node(节点)至少运行: Kubelet,负责 master 节点...
在kubernetes中,Pod是最小的控制单元,但是kubernetes很少直接控制Pod,一般都是通过Pod控制器来完成的。Pod控制器用于pod的管理,确保pod资源符合预期的状态,当pod的资源出现故障时,会尝试进行重启或重建pod。在kubernetes中Pod控制器的种类有很多,本章节只介绍一种:Deployment。